Summary:The Chief Commercial Officer (CCO) will be responsible for building and managing the project development portfolio and maximizing returns on development capital investments in utility-scale wind, solar, and storage development projects across the Americas region. This professional will hold responsibility for development project origination and full-cycle project development (up to NTP) as well as portfolio management and capital recycling initiatives, including the acquisition and divestiture of development project(s). S/he will drive development efforts for wind, solar, and storage projects with multiple internal and external stakeholders, working closely with EPC, O&M, and other functional resources to ensure high quality project development and sales.
Requirements:Leads the project origination and development program for wind, solar, storage, and hydrogen, including greenfield development and M&A and development portfolio management initiatives, across the Americas region.Identifies and analyzes project and portfolio acquisitions as well as market and technology diversification and expansion opportunities for growth of the Company.Maximizes value creation through the optimal deployment of allocated resources, steering the development pipeline via project origination, portfolio and individual project prioritization and divestitures, and resource allocation.Ensures high quality project development and delivery using tools such as quality reviews, analyses and adequate monitoring and reporting systems.Leads a team of commercial professionals focused on maximizing the value of the development portfolio and individual projects, through the origination, structuring, negotiation, and closing of project transactions.Manages RES' efforts to develop and cultivate relationships across utility and corporate clients.Drives the structuring of complex transactions, including conducting and directing multiple types of quantitative and risk-based analysis.Collaborates closely with finance team members to analyze the impacts of covariance and basis, assess contractual terms and the financial impacts of various deal structures to inform the negotiating position.Drives the creation of innovative deal structures that equitably distribute risk; and responds to and/or directing responses to RFPs and develop other proposal documentation.Bidding for and securing power offtake agreements.Leads a team of development professionals who manage all phases of project development from land identification to project divestiture.Due diligence on projects to identify fatal flaws in siting, design, permitting, interconnects, PPAs, RECs, and other project issues.Adherence to quantitative and qualitative requirements of both tax equity and equity investors.Works with the in-house engineering team to inform bidding process, respond to customer specifications, and track bid status.Partners with project finance team on key issues necessary to finance the projects with tax equity and debt; and manages project portfolio risk across the entire development and commercial value chain.Manages development budget for region and gains approval for development expenditures above a certain threshold.Recruits, develops, motivates, and retains high performance teams and ensures the Company has the talent to achieve its growth strategies.Qualifications:Bachelor's degree in Business, Finance, Economics or Engineering required.Master's degree in Business, Finance, Economics, or Engineering preferred.Minimum of 15 years' experience in energy project development, driving projects to completion, deal structuring and interacting with various counterparties.Domestic and International travel required 16%-30%.RES is an equal opportunity employer that is committed to diversity and inclusion in the workplace.
